The novel coronavirus, or COVID-19, pandemic has spread across 185 countries and territories. Today is the 25th day of India’s nationwide lockdown, which has been extended till May 3. Confirmed COVID-19 cases in India stand at 14,792. The death toll from the outbreak in India is at 488. Maharashtra, Delhi and Tamil Nadu have reported the highest number of cases.
Globally, over 2 million cases of COVID-19 infections have been reported, with 154,291 people having lost their lives, according to the World Health Organisation's (WHO) latest update. The United States has the highest number of confirmed cases, followed by Spain, Italy, France and Germany. The outbreak continues to have a major impact on the global economy. Over 270 cases were registered and 3,608 people detained in Delhi today for violating lockdown orders, police said.
According to the data shared by the police, 271 cases were registered under section 188 (for disobedience to order duly promulgated by public servant) of the Indian Penal Code till 5 pm.
A total of 3,608 people were detained under section 65 (persons bound to comply with reasonable directions of police officers) and 301 vehicles have been impounded under section 66 of the Delhi Police Act, the data showed. (PTI)

Coronavirus LIVE updates | In India, mortality has been around 3.3% so far. Distribution of deaths by age group is as follows:
# 0-45 age group - 14.4%
# 45-60 age group- 10.3%
# 60-75 age group - 33.1%
# Above 75 years of age- 42.2%
(Source: Ministry of Health and Family Welfare)

Coronavirus in India LIVE updates | Of 14,378 COVID-19 infections, 4,291 cases linked to Markaz event in Delhi: Health ministry
Of the 14,378 coronavirus infections reported in the country so far, 4,291 cases in 23 states and Union Territories are linked to the Markaz event held in Delhi's Nizamuddin area in March, the Union health ministry said today.
Addressing a daily media briefing to give updates on the COVID-19 situation in the country, Joint Secretary in the Health Ministry Lav Agarwal said most of the Markaz event-related cases have been found in states with high burden of the disease, such as Tamil Nadu (84%), Telengana (79%), Delhi (63%), Uttar Pradesh (59%) and Andhra Pradesh (61%).

Mortality rate in India is around 3.3%. An age-wise analysis shows that 14.4% of deaths have been reported in the age group of 0-45 yrs. Between 45-60 yrs it is 10.3%, between 60-75 yrs it is 33.1% and for 75 yrs and above it is 42.2%: Lav Aggarwal, Joint Secretary, Health Ministry (ANI)
